Abstract

The invention discloses a computer battery plate with a built-tin antenna. The computer battery plate with the built-tin antenna comprises a battery plate body, the antenna and a metal sheet, wherein a groove is formed in the battery plate body, the antenna is arranged in the groove, a feeding point and a grounding point are arranged at the end of the antenna, the feeding point and the grounding point are both connected with a mainboard in the battery plate body, the part, with the antenna, in the battery plate body is wrapped in the metal sheet, a long and thin small protrusion is formed in the portion, above the groove, of the metal sheet, and the upper portion of the antenna can be wrapped in the long and thin protrusion. According to the computer battery plate with the built-in antenna, due to the combination mode that the antenna is embedded in the battery plate body, the computer battery plate with space saved can be manufactured, irradiation can be reduced, the size of the antenna can be reduced, a sleeve is arranged on the antenna, the sleeve is further wrapped in the metal sheet, signal receiving can be enhanced, and the computer battery plate with the built-tin antenna is applicable to smaller portable notebook computers.

Background technology
Antenna is a kind of converter, and it is transformed into the guided wave of transmission above-the-line promotion to propagate in unbounded medium electromagnetic wave, or carry out contrary conversion.? radiobe used in equipment launching or receiving electromagnetic parts.Radio communication, broadcast, TV, radar, navigation, electronic countermeasures, remote sensing, the engineering system such as radio astronomy, every electromagnetic wave that utilizes carrys out transmission of information, all relies on antenna to carry out work.
The range of application of present computer is more and more extensive, but brings puzzlement to the use of people in the problem of the frequent signal difference of computer always.Although existing built-in antenna does not see antenna at the outer surface of computer, there is the problems such as frequency range is very wide, Received signal strength weak effect in this type of built-in aerial mostly.People also more and more like portable, light and handy laptop computer, but bulky due to it, cause certain inconvenience.
Antenna is an important devices of concentrated reflection computer radiate performance.In recent years, panel computer obtains development at full speed, and panel computer antenna is tending towards multifrequency; Panel computer antenna often adopts Monopole antenna, although Monopole antenna is by the restriction of volume, specific absorption rate SAR and Specific Absorption Rate and human body sensing index are not particularly good always.Current SAR spoken of in the world, all for cellular mobile phone, be commonly called as the radiation that the Wireless Telecom Equipments such as mobile phone produce, namely under the effect of external electromagnetic field, induction field will be produced in human body, because the various organ of human body is lossy dielectric, therefore in body, electromagnetic field will generation current, causes absorbing and dissipative electromagnetic energy.The RF energy of antenna for mobile phone institute radiation can be absorbed by the body and produce heat, and is transmitted by the thermoregulatory system of human body.The definition of SAR is the ratio weighing human brain and absorption of human body or consumption electromagnetic power, that the how many radio frequency radiation energy of metering is by the representation unit of health institute actual absorption, be called special contribution ratios or claim SAR, representing with watt/every kilogram or milliwatt/every gram.The test of SAR is the radio wave energy produced via Wireless Telecom Equipment, measures human body actually by testing equipment, namely brain or body absorption how many electromagenetic wave radiations.And the induction index of panel computer test mainly refers to human body indicators, test mode is mainly the process that simulation people normally uses panel computer, allows panel computer press close to manikin, simulated human tissue liquid is housed inside manikin.Learn that panel computer is in real work by such test model, be absorbed by the body how many electromagenetic wave radiation energy.Standard international at present has two, and one is European standard 2w/kg, and one is Unite States Standard 1.6w/kg, and its concrete meaning refers to, with 6 minutes for timing, the electromagnetic radiation energy that per kilogram tissue absorbs must not more than 2 watts.Test through actual items finds, the SAR index of the panel computer of Monopole antenna form is easy to exceed standard.

In the embodiment of the present invention, a kind of computer battery plate that built-in aerial is housed, comprise cell panel body 1, antenna 2 and sheet metal 5, cell panel body 1 offers groove, antenna 2 is arranged in groove, and groove can be the shapes such as circle, ellipse, triangle or polygon, and groove carries out arranging according to the shape of antenna, antenna 2 end is provided with distributing point 3 and earth point 9, and distributing point 3, earth point 9 are all connected with mainboard in cell panel body 1.Metal sleeve installed by antenna 2, the further broadening bandwidth of operation of antenna, and the metal sleeve loaded can improve the symmetry of antenna horizontal plane CURRENT DISTRIBUTION, improves omnidirectional's characteristic of antenna.
Be provided with some protruding 4 in groove, antenna 2 offers some through holes, through hole is connected with protruding 4, antenna 2 can be made effectively to be connected in groove, be connected firmly, there will not be loosening by this structure.Sheet metal 5 adopts iron material matter, and sheet metal 5 wraps the part containing antenna 2 in cell panel body 1, and sheet metal 5 has elongated kick 6 above groove, and elongated kick can be wrapped in the top of antenna 2, strengthens the reception of signal.Namely kick 6 curved surface that sheet metal is formed, to strengthen the directivity of antenna in specific direction set by electromagnetic wave by this curved surface.Kick 6 curved surface formed by sheet metal strengthens the signal strength signal intensity of antenna, and then the antenna increasing electronic installation receives the chance of signal.The sheet metal 5 of iron material matter more can strengthen signal strength signal intensity.
Refer to Fig. 5, antenna 2 adopts copper or aluminium material, and antenna 2 comprises inverted-L antenna or loop aerial.The terminating load impedance of loop aerial can be zero, also can equal the characteristic impedance of ring, the CURRENT DISTRIBUTION on it and ribbon feeder similar.Electric current on the little ring of electricity is approximate by the same Entropy density deviation of constant amplitude.On TV university ring, electric current is standing wave distribution.When the impedance of terminating load equals the characteristic impedance of ring, the electric current on ring is row wavelength-division cloth.According to the dual character principle of electromagnetic radiation, electricity little ring and perpendicular to anchor ring place small electronic couple pole antenna radiation field except will electricity and magnetic amount exchange except be all similar, namely in the plane of anchor ring, directional diagram is round, and in the plane of annulate shaft place, directional diagram is 8-shaped, is zero along the axial radiation of ring.Ring can be hollow or magnetic core; Single turn or multiturn.Theoretical and experiment proves, the electric current on the area of radiation field and ring, the number of turn and ring is directly proportional, and is inversely proportional to the quadratic sum distance of operation wavelength; Little with the shape relation of ring.Loop aerial can be rectangle, also can be the shapes such as circle, ellipse, triangle or polygon.Inverted-L antenna comprises the HF link 7 producing high-frequency signal and the audio line 8 producing low frequency signal, HF link is an inverted-L antenna extended from distributing point 3, described audio line is the inverted-L antenna extended from earth point 9, audio line is located at HF link periphery with semi-surrounding form, and audio line and HF link are coupled mutually and produce another low frequency signal.Double-fed point mode taked by antenna 2, from distributing point 3 side pull-out " L " type cabling, produce HFS, the trace portions around " L " type is pulled out from earth point, produce low frequency part, both within the scope of the second harmonic immigration 3G of low frequency around making, form the high-frequency band of another part, obtain a reasonable antenna performance.By these specific cabling forms, antenna can be allowed to obtain a reasonable Electro Magnetic Compatibility, especially when not affecting OTA and active test performance, SAR can obtain reasonable performance.Distance between distributing point and earth point needs debug process to determine, the process of debugging also can use match circuit tuning.The Electro Magnetic Compatibility of antenna 2 inherently settlement computer antenna, reduces SAR index, improves the overall performance improving computer, improve the design of computer antenna.At present domestic mention SAR scheme is fallen except reducing OTA index, add absorbing material exactly, not only reduce the overall performance of antenna, and too increase production cost, so the inverted-L antenna adopted in the present invention to have great significance on reducing costs at improving performance.

SAR test is carried out to the computer battery plate that built-in aerial is housed prepared by the embodiment of the present invention 1 and embodiment 2, and do not use computer battery plate of the present invention to compare with the computer of same model simultaneously, with 6 minutes for timing, test for carrying out 10 groups of tests, to average and by as shown in table 1 for the electromagnetic radiation energy outcome record measuring tissue absorption.
Table 1
Embodiment SAR value (w/kg)
Embodiment 1 1.4
Embodiment 2 1.2
Comparative example 1 2.2
As can be seen from Table 1, the SAR value of embodiment 1 is 1.4w/kg, the SAR value of embodiment 2 is 1.2w/kg, SAR value in the SAR value of embodiment 1 and embodiment 2 is all in the scope of international standard 2w/kg, and the SAR value of comparative example 1 is beyond the scope of international standard 2w/kg, wherein, the SAR value of embodiment 1 decreases 36.4% than the SAR value of comparative example 1, and the SAR value of embodiment 2 decreases 45.5% than the SAR value of comparative example 1.Use the computer battery plate that built-in aerial is housed prepared by the present invention, reduce radiation, thus reduce the injury to human body.
